Subject: Re: [PATCH v3 net-next] sfc: correct kernel-doc complaints

Hello:

This patch was applied to netdev/net-next.git (main)
by Jakub Kicinski <kuba@...nel.org>:

On Tue,  6 Jan 2026 09:32:24 -0800 you wrote:
> Fix kernel-doc warnings by adding 3 missing struct member descriptions
> in struct efx_ef10_nic_data and removing preprocessor directives (which
> are not handled by kernel-doc).
> 
> Fixes these 5 warnings:
> Warning: drivers/net/ethernet/sfc/nic.h:158 bad line: #ifdef CONFIG_SFC_SRIOV
> Warning: drivers/net/ethernet/sfc/nic.h:160 bad line: #endif
> Warning: drivers/net/ethernet/sfc/nic.h:204 struct member 'port_id'
>  not described in 'efx_ef10_nic_data'
> Warning: drivers/net/ethernet/sfc/nic.h:204 struct member 'vf_index'
>  not described in 'efx_ef10_nic_data'
> Warning: drivers/net/ethernet/sfc/nic.h:204 struct member 'licensed_features'
>  not described in 'efx_ef10_nic_data'
